Verdict

John Gosden's REGENT got the hang of things as the contest wore on at Kempton just over a fortnight ago, doing her best work late having lost all chance of making a winning debut at the start. With significant improvement on the cards, she's taken to score second-time up. Colour of Light heads up the dangers having also been held back by greenness on debut, ahead of Lexington Liberty.
